Is it worth the extra $1200 to $1400 for the ltr450 over the ltz400?
Theres thousands of dollars in performance upgrades for the 400. I would get that instead of
the r450. w/ $1200 you can pipe and jet it, put an air filter on, it, take off the airbox lid and
install a k&n lid, etc. Those are the first few things I would do to it. Then they have a 440 big
bore kit for it. Thats only about $250. Then maybe change the gearing w/ sprockets. Or
if you dont want just engine performance, they have tons of tires for it/wheel packages.
Works shocks are good but will take up a lot of money, so if you dont like the stock shocks
just adjust them. Also, if you like twist throttles they have them for the z. And a new
aftermarket chain would be a good thing to get.
So if you're looking for engine performance, get the first things I listed. I wouldnt spend all
the 1200 on engine parts, though. Skidplates are usually a must for trail riding and stuff.

Is it worth the extra $1200 to $1400 for the ltr450 over the ltz400?
It depends on what you are doing with it. But if you are asking if the 450 is $1200 more of bike than the 400 then the answer is yes. For only $1200 it's doubtful you could make a 400 as good as a stock 450.
For reference consider that the Team Suzuki 400s last year had about $20000 into them.

Is it worth the extra $1200 to $1400 for the ltr450 over the ltz400?
it depends on what your doing with it,if you want to race MX then go R450,but for woods and just trail get the Z400.For $1200 you could buy 440 kit,pipe,jets,performance air filters,good tires, and that would make a awsome Z.but if you trail ride a R450 would suck because they are set up for MX.
